06/25/26: Crime, Courts, Accident & Incidents

• Accused of selling drugs Samuel Skogman, 57, of Sheldon, was arrested on June 16 after he allegedly sold methamphetamine to someone working with the Sheldon Police Department. The report states that Skogman was the subject of a controlled transaction by Sheldon police in which he agreed to sell methamphetamine for cash.
